tauri2-vue3os内置了macos
和windows
两种桌面风格模式、自研拖拽式栅格引擎、封装tauri2多窗口管理、自定义json配置桌面/Dock菜单。
使用技术
- 技术框架:vite6.0.3+vue3.5.13+vue-router^4.5.0
- 跨平台框架:tauri^2.1.1
- UI组件库:@arco-design/web-vue^2.56.3 (字节桌面版vue3组件库)
- 状态管理:pinia^2.3.0
- 拖拽插件:sortablejs^1.15.6
- 滑动分屏插件:swiper^11.1.15
- 图表组件:echarts^5.5.1
- markdown编辑器:md-editor-v3^5.1.1
- 模拟数据:mockjs^1.1.0
项目框架结构
tauri2-os使用最新跨平台框架Tauri2.0
结合Vite6.x
搭建项目框架。
目前该项目tauri2-vue3-os桌面os已经同步到我的原创作品集。
https://gf.bilibili.com/item/detail/1107621011
之前有开发一款Electron32+vue3桌面端os系统,感兴趣的可以去看看。
Electron32-ViteOS桌面版os系统|vue3+electron+arco客户端OS管理模板
整个项目涉及到的知识点还是非常多,如果想要了解更加详细的技术实现,可以去看看下面这篇分享文章。
https://www.cnblogs.com/xiaoyan2017/p/18618163
点击查看更多内容
1人点赞
评论
共同学习,写下你的评论
评论加载中...
作者其他优质文章
正在加载中
感谢您的支持,我会继续努力的~
扫码打赏,你说多少就多少
赞赏金额会直接到老师账户
支付方式
打开微信扫一扫,即可进行扫码打赏哦